public final class SqlNode extends DeployableTextNode
SqlNode
class is a TextNode that represents an SQL or
PL/SQL file.TextNode
Modifier and Type | Field and Description |
---|---|
static java.lang.String |
EXT
Extension for this file type
|
static java.lang.String |
PLSQL_BODY_EXT |
static java.lang.String |
PLSQL_EXT |
static java.lang.String |
PLSQL_SPEC_EXT |
static URLFilter |
SQL_FILTER |
EXT2
LOG_READONLY
Modifier and Type | Method and Description |
---|---|
javax.swing.Icon |
getIcon()
Displayable interface method. |
void |
setIcon(javax.swing.Icon icon) |
acquireTextBuffer, acquireTextBufferInterruptibly, acquireTextBufferOrThrow, addTextBufferListener, closeImpl, createOutputStreamWriter, createReader, facadeBuffer, getInputStream, getInputStream, getLoadEncoding, getReader, getSaveEncoding, getTextBufferDirectly, hasEmptyTextBuffer, isDirty, isReadOnly, markDirty, markDirtyImpl, openImpl, readUnlock, releaseTextBuffer, removeTextBufferListener, reportOpenException, revertImpl, saveImpl, setDefaultLineTerminator, setLoadEncoding, setSaveEncoding, tryAcquireTextBuffer, upgradeUnlock, urlReadOnlyChanged, writeUnlock
addNodeListener, addNodeListenerForType, addNodeListenerForTypeHierarchy, attach, beginThreadNodeUsageCycle, callUnderReadLock, callUnderWriteLock, close, createSubject, delete, deleteImpl, detach, endThreadNodeUsage, endThreadNodeUsageCycle, ensureOpen, equalsImpl, getAttributes, getChildren, getData, getLongLabel, getShortLabel, getSubject, getTimestamp, getTimestampLoadedUnsafe, getToolTipText, getTransientProperties, getUnmodifiedTimestamp, getURL, isLoaded, isLockHeld, isMigrating, isNew, isOpen, isReadLocked, isReadLockHeld, isReadOrWriteLocked, isTrackedInNodeCache, isTrackingThreadNodeUsage, isWriteLocked, isWriteLockHeld, lockCount, mayHaveChildren, nodeLock, notifyObservers, open, readLock, readLockCount, readLockInterruptibly, refreshTimestamp, removeNodeListener, removeNodeListenerForType, removeNodeListenerForTypeHierarchy, rename, renameImpl, revert, runUnderReadLock, runUnderWriteLock, save, setEventLog, setMigrating, setOpen, setReadOnly, setTimestampDirectly, setURL, toString, tryRunUnderReadLock, tryRunUnderWriteLock, unsetMigrating, upgradeLock, writeLock, writeLockCount, writeLockInterruptibly
public static final java.lang.String EXT
public static final java.lang.String PLSQL_EXT
public static final java.lang.String PLSQL_BODY_EXT
public static final java.lang.String PLSQL_SPEC_EXT
public static URLFilter SQL_FILTER
public javax.swing.Icon getIcon()
Node
Displayable
interface method. The Node class returns
a generic icon.getIcon
in interface Displayable
getIcon
in class Node
Icon
to be displayed for the
Displayable
.public void setIcon(javax.swing.Icon icon)